Singapore’s move to further ease border controls as well as social restrictions have led to an uptick in hotel enquires and bookings from countries with a vaccinated travel lane (VTL) with the city-state.
To date, Singapore has launched VTLs with Australia, Brunei, Canada, Denmark, France, Germany, Italy, the Netherlands, South Korea, Spain, Switzerland, the UK, and the US and will be commencing with Malaysia, Finland, Sweden, Indonesia and India from November 29. There are intentions to do the same with Qatar, Saudi Arabia, and the United Arab Emirates from December 6 – bringing the total VTL countries to an eventual 21.
